What Is a Ryobi Weed Wacker Head?

A Ryobi weed wacker head is the rotating front part that holds the cutting line. It bolts to the end of the drive shaft on your string trimmer. Ryobi operates as a flagship brand of Techtronic Industries, a global power tool maker.

The head spins fast to slice grass and weeds with nylon line. Many users call the tool a weed eater, line trimmer, or brush cutter. Ryobi sells these heads for both cordless electric and gas models.

According to Ryobi brand pages, the company distributes products in over 120 countries these days. That wide reach means parts stay easy to find at local stores and online.

Important: Always remove the battery or spark plug before you handle the head. This step stops sudden spins that can break bones.

Common Ryobi Head Types

  • The bump feed head releases line when you tap it on the ground during spin.
  • The auto feed head pushes line out by itself as the string wears short.
  • The fixed line head uses pre-cut pieces you slide into slots by hand.
  • The bladed head swaps line for plastic or metal blades on rough brush.
  • The universal head adapts to many shaft sizes with a set screw kit.

Each style fits certain Ryobi families sold at Home Depot and Amazon. Your model number on the shaft decal decides the correct match.

How Does the Bump Feed Mechanism Work?

The bump feed system uses a spring-loaded spool inside a round housing. When you press the head on the soil, the spool pushes down against the spring. This movement frees a small length of line from the spool.

At spin speed, centrifugal force pulls the line outward through the eyelets. The line cuts grass with its tip. When you stop tapping, the spring seats the spool back to rest.

This design appears on most Ryobi consumer trimmers nowadays. It balances low cost with user control over line length.

Key Parts of the Head

  • The spool is the plastic reel that stores wound trimmer line.
  • The bump knob screws to the base and touches the ground.
  • The eyelets are the holes where line exits the housing.
  • The spring returns the spool after each tap action.
  • The cover clips on top to shield the spool from debris.

Warning: Cracked eyelets slice the line prematurely. Replace the whole head if the plastic around the holes shows stress marks.

What You Need Before You Start

Collect simple tools to repair most head faults at home. You probably own many of these items already.

Tools and Materials

  • A flathead screwdriver pries open the head cover tabs with ease.
  • A T20 Torx bit removes hidden screws on newer Ryobi heads.
  • Pliers pull a stuck spool or old line from the cavity.
  • Replacement trimmer line in the gauge your label specifies, often 0.065 to 0.095 inch.
  • A new bump knob or full head if the plastic snapped.
  • Clean rags wipe sap and grass paste from the spool seat.
  • Safety glasses shield your eyes from line snippets.

How to Fix Ryobi Weed Wacker Head: Core Repair Steps

This section shows how to fix ryobi weed wacker head faults with direct actions. Pick the steps that match your problem.

How to Remove the Head from the Shaft

  1. Cut power by pulling the battery or spark plug wire.
  2. Lay the trimmer on a flat surface with the head facing up.
  3. Look for a retaining nut or bolt at the head base.
  4. Hold the shaft with one hand and turn the nut counterclockwise.
  5. Slide the head off the drive shaft once the nut is free.

Step-by-Step Process for a Jammed Head

  1. Place the head on a bench with the cover facing upward.
  2. Press the side tabs with a screwdriver and lift the cover.
  3. Pull the spool out and cut away any fused or tangled line.
  4. Scrape the cavity clean with a rag to remove dirt clumps.
  5. Inspect the spring for rust and wipe it with light oil.
  6. Rewind fresh line onto the spool following the arrow.
  7. Seat the spool and click the cover until it locks.

How to Rewind the Line Correctly

  1. Cut two equal line pieces, roughly 9 feet each for single feed.
  2. Push one end into the anchor slot on the spool hub.
  3. Wind the line tight in the arrow direction shown on the spool.
  4. Leave 6 inches free and thread it through the matching eyelet.
  5. Repeat on the second side if your head uses dual line.

How to Replace a Broken Bump Knob

  1. Unscrew the old knob from the head base with pliers if stuck.
  2. Brush the threaded post clean and check for housing cracks.
  3. Screw the new knob on by hand then snug with a gentle turn.
  4. Tap the knob on soil to confirm it springs back smoothly.
